Considerations for Determining the Value of Coins
Here are some factors to consider when determining the value of a coin collectible:
- Condition: The condition of a old coin is a critical factor in determining its value. Coins in excellent condition are generally worth more than those with signs of wear and tear.
- Rarity: Rare coins are naturally more valuable than common ones. The rarity of a coin is determined by its mintage, the number of coins produced in a particular year.
- Age: Coins that are older, especially those that date back to ancient times, are usually more valuable.
- Historical significance: Coins that have a significant historical significance or were produced during a particular event or era can be worth more.
- Demand: The demand for a particular coin can impact its value. Coins that are in high demand among collectors are often more valuable.
- Mint error: Coins with mint errors, such as double-struck coins or those with misprints, can be worth more than normal coins.
- Grading: The process of grading a coin by a professional coin grading service can provide an accurate evaluation of its condition and value.
- Market trends: Like any other market, the coin collectibles market can be influenced by various economic and political factors. It is essential to stay informed about current market trends to accurately determine the value of a coin.
